Chili curry



Ingredients
Anaheim Chilies- 6( long mild green chili)
Onion- 1 large chopped finely
Turmeric powder- 1/4tsp
Tamarind paste- 1tsp
Salt- as needed


For grinding
Peanuts- 1/4 cup roasted
White sesame seeds- 3tbsp
Dry coconut powder- 2tbsp
Dried red chili- 4
Coriander seeds- 1tbsp
Cumin seeds- 1tsp
Cinnamon- 1"
Cloves- 2


Method

  1. Fry the chilies in 1tbsp of oil until soft. Drain in a paper towel and set it aside.
  2. In 1 tbsp of oil , fry the ingredients listed for grinding(add the coconut powder in the end so as not to burn it). Grind  with 1/2 cup of water and the tamarind paste.
  3. In a pan, heat oil and splutter mustard and cumin seeds. Add curry leaves.
  4. Add the ground paste to the pan and fry well. Add water according to desired consistency and bring to a boil. Add the fried chilies and cook for 10 more minutes.
  5. Remove from heat and serve warm with zeera rice or rotis.
